Output e6c8a4b9c183f7b39fb6ed133a4a667186bdf7d9c6703846c5a8bc89ff190837:1

value
1452469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faab70c8e59be3a2a2a65504594c7e33ef75f6c0 OP_EQUAL
address
3QYSEQC8ED725btEYMfPjqqBsYUGwh7wWL
transaction
e6c8a4b9c183f7b39fb6ed133a4a667186bdf7d9c6703846c5a8bc89ff190837
spent
true